Abstract

The invention discloses a building method of a biogas digester. The method is characterized by including the following steps that setting-out is conducted according to the design size; a digester pit is dug; a reinforced concrete digester base of a set size is built in the digester pit, wherein the digester base is cylindrical; an arch top cover is spirally built at the upper end of the digester base with bricks, wherein the arch top cover and the digester base serve as a biogas digester base body; one side of the bottom end of the biogas digester is provided with a discharging port, and the top cover is provided with a gas outlet and a feeding port; the exterior of the biogas digester base body is paved with a rebar mesh and three sand-cement coatings, and the inner wall of the biogas digester base body is brushed with cement paste three times. The biogas digester built through the method is solid and durable and does not crack or leak gas or water. Specific embodiment
Embodiment one
A kind of preparation method of methane-generating pit, it is characterised in that comprise the steps:
1), dig melt pit, diameter 5m, high 4.4m.
2), build a methane generating pit pedestal 1 in hole, the internal diameter r of methane-generating pit pedestal 1 is 4m, and high 1.5m, pedestal 1 is reinforced concrete Soil matrix seat, wall thickness 120mm.
3), in the upper end brick rotation of pedestal 1 set arch top cover 2, the inside and outside wall of top cover 2 concrete brushing and the thickness one of pedestal 1 Sample, and be biomass pool body for an overall structure.
4), be provided with biomass pool body arch top cover 2 charging aperture 3 and gas outlet 4, discharging opening 5 is left in biomass pool body bottom, Discharging opening internal diameter is 1.2m, and the bar-mat reinforcement 6 of 100 100mm is laid on biomass pool body outer wall, then erects and applies the thick of 15-20mm thickness Husky cement layer 7, bar-mat reinforcement is embedded in rough sand cement layer, wet curing 12-24 hours, then laterally brushes husky cement layer 8, thick 10-15mm, vertically applies again fine sand cement layer 9, thick 10-15mm, wet curing after wet curing 12-24 hours.
5), from discharging opening 5 enter biomass pool body in, one layer of cement mortar of vertical brush, slightly dry one layer of cement mortar of horizontal brush again, slightly It is dry, last one layer of cement mortar of vertical brush again.
6), seal charging aperture, discharging opening and gas outlet, suppress(Water or air pressure), without leakage phenomenon after, from discharging opening by repairing Expects pipe 10 arrives ground.
7), backfill, compacting.The methane-generating pit arch top cover upper end 400-450cm that bankets is thick, obtains final product.
